When Water Heaters Have Problems

Do you know the signs of a water heater in need of repair? Some water heaters last 7 years while others have a life expectancy of closer to 20. However, if you experience any of the following, call a professional:

  • The water in your sinks and showers doesn’t get hot or is too hot
  • Your water comes out at a low pressure
  • There is a leak around your unit
  • Your water smells bad
  • You hear unusual sounds coming from your unit
